One potato, two potato, three potato, four - sweet potatoes needn't be a sugar-laden bore.

Most of us, if we consider sweet potatoes at all, think of them as bit players at Thanksgiving dinner, bizarrely topped with marshmallows and adding that requisite touch of orange to the plate. But these nutritious tubers, high in vitamin A and beta carotenes, can be so much more.
